Hallo,
das Programm was ich geschrieben habe war irgendwo falsch gewesen. Ausserdem gibt es in Bascom eine vie einfachere Variante der Umwandlung.
Das ist nur ein Auszug aus dem Programm. Du gibst also ein Wert für den DAC vor. Den Übergibst du in das Unterprogramm was dann die einzelnen Ports richtig setzt.Code:Declare Sub Write_Port ... Write_port Dac 'Wertübergabe an DA Wandler ... Sub Write_port(x As Byte) Portd.2 = X.7 Portd.3 = X.6 Portd.4 = X.5 Portd.5 = X.4 Portd.6 = X.3 Portd.7 = X.2 Portc.1 = X.1 Portc.0 = X.0 End Sub
Hoffe das Hilft dir weiter.
cu Arno
Lesezeichen